Transaction 70f2a833b7aae21a805147160b7de1356f49a15c2301e6005d5fcf070206a00a

10 Input
2 Outputs
  • 70f2a833b7aae21a805147160b7de1356f49a15c2301e6005d5fcf070206a00a:0
  • value  185254
    address  bc1qjar32tfkkcxne7zfgldxrxe0dm690a6ksur4xe
  • 70f2a833b7aae21a805147160b7de1356f49a15c2301e6005d5fcf070206a00a:1
  • value  17173394
    address  3DE5b5j7cwYx65thY7PybVZCoLban54tkC